>> No.21337307

>>21337297
i have morphman installed and working fine and i also know that your PC isnt magic so ur wrong

>> No.21337310

>>21337304
you know what's even better, deleting your shit, starting a new mining deck and only doing like 5 or 10 new cards per day so you make sure to stay under 15 minutes daily

>> No.21337312

>>21337297
you are putting the morphman 4.0 in the addons folder instead of putting the contents of the morphman4.0 inside your addons folder

>> No.21337313

>>21337279
oh look incel guy is back lmao

>> No.21337315

>>21337301
you can use text analysers to find out the frequency but it wont sort your entire deck for you on that basis, you'd have to do it yourself manually. im talking about in the case of already having a mining deck and you sort it based on the frequency of whatever VN you're currently playing. you cant do that manually

>> No.21337316

>>21337304
>not spending 2 hours on it
i'm really confused by this because i don't cap my reviews to 100 and i get done with anki in 8-10 minutes a day. because i just limit the number of new cards i do such that my review count never gets that high. although by the nature of my cards it would still never take me more than 20-30 minutes at worst so you're probably doing dumb cards

>> No.21337320

>>21337279
kys fucking scumbag

>> No.21337324
File: 129 KB, 1366x634, file.png [View same] [iqdb] [saucenao] [google]
